Chapter 143 What?! Your little bear?!
Chapter 143 What?! Your little bear?!
The two bear cubs sat on the spot, their bodies stained with blood, but they turned their heads as if looking at something intently.
Guo Mi's gaze fell on their wounds, silently counting:
One, two, three...
In the end, she couldn't count anymore. A somber aura enveloped the entire bear, and she walked heavily toward the cub.
Hearing the rustling of the grass, the fishbone touched its nose, suddenly froze, then its eyes brightened, and it turned around, exclaiming in surprise:
"Guo Mi!"
The salmon quickly turned around, and upon seeing Guo Mi, its eyes immediately welled up with tears. It excitedly cried out:
"Guo Mi!"
The two bear cubs rushed towards Guo Mi, one after the other, and hugged her front paws tightly, burying their heads in her thick white fur and rubbing against her.
"Oh, Guo Mi..."
They just kept calling Guo Mi's name and trying their best to get close to her, but they never mentioned the hardships and grievances they had endured along the way.
Hearing these calls, Guo Mi felt so heartbroken she could wring out sour water, and her body stiffened terribly.
Being so close, the wounds on the bear's body became even more noticeable.
Wolf teeth have difficulty penetrating the polar bear's fat layer, so once they bite, they will violently shake their heads and tear at it.
The wounds on the bear's body were increasingly gruesome, most of them left by being bitten and pulled forcefully, with obvious traces of tearing flesh.
Guo Mi felt more and more heartbroken as she looked at it; she had never regretted it more than she did now.
He lowered his head and licked the little bear's forehead, then licked its little ears, his voice dry and hoarse:
"sorry."
If they had returned to the bear cubs immediately after encountering the wolf pack, they wouldn't have so many injuries now.
The salmon's little face was hidden in Guomi's fur. Hearing Guomi's apology, it tightened its grip on her front paws, and after a long while, it whispered:
"Guo Mi, Yu Gu and I were very scared and disappointed when we saw the wolves..."
Guo Mi felt a pang of guilt, realizing she truly deserved to be disappointed.
With such an irresponsible big bear like her, abandoning the little bears in danger, neither rushing to their side when they were in danger nor teaching them what to do in a dangerous situation.
To simply abandon a clueless bear cub in an unfamiliar wilderness and try to let the world teach it how to survive is nothing short of shirking responsibility.
Thinking of all this, Guo Mi's eyelids drooped, and the self-reproach in her heart almost overwhelmed her.
The little bear's words were still echoing intermittently:
"We are afraid of pain and disappointed in our own powerlessness."
The moment the words left her lips, Guo Mi was stunned. She lowered her head and stared blankly at the top of the bear's head.
The little one held her paws, raised his little head to look at her, his dark, beady eyes full of seriousness:
“We are disappointed in ourselves. We have been living by your side all this time, but we failed to remember how you went to great lengths to cover up the smell of food. As a result, our negligence attracted the wolves, and in the end, we could only rely on you to escape.”
Fishbone also whispered from the side:
“You’ve always been brave enough to face any challenge, even when facing a male bear that’s bigger than you, but when facing a pack of wolves, all I could think about was running away and calling for help. I didn’t even have the courage to fight back.”
He didn't dare look Guo Mi in the eye like his sister did. Compared to the salmon who later calmly thought things through and bravely resisted, he seemed to have played no role at all.
Even though he was the male bear, and was much bigger than the salmon, he still hid behind her.
Fishbone couldn't hold back any longer and started to cry, choking out:
"I'm sorry, I don't look like a male bear at all..."
I was crying for a while when I realized that crying was a sign of weakness. When I was surrounded by wolves, I couldn't help but keep crying. I tried my best to hold it in, and in the end, my eyes were bloodshot from holding it in.
More painful than the physical wounds was the mental burden on Yugu's heart.
The salmon interrupted him loudly before he could finish speaking:
"How is it not like one? You're a little male bear!"
"Who says male bears have to be braver than female bears? And haven't you been helping me drive away the wolves that were biting me?"
She paused, turned her head, and looked at Guo Mi anxiously:
"Guo Mi, Yu Gu has been helping me the whole time; he hasn't backed down!"
The little bear looked at her pleading eyes. She knew that Fishbone was actually hoping that she could meet Guo Mi's expectations, which was why she was so sad.
To meet Guo Mi's expectations... unfortunately, they failed to do so, and the salmon also felt disappointed, but quickly rallied and spoke earnestly, word by word:
"Guo Mi, we'll be stronger and calmer next time, and we definitely won't let you down!"
Ever since they learned that Guo Mi hadn't left, the two little bears had treated this journey as a test, and both believed they had failed.
Guo Mi paused for a moment, then suddenly realized that the little bear had misunderstood. She lowered her head and whispered:
"You have never let me down, never."
She looked back at the salmon, equally intently:
"Salmon, fish bones, this is not a test. I will never test you. Don't limit yourself because of me. There is no definition of an excellent polar bear. The important thing is that you become the person you aspire to be."
She didn't see this journey as a test; from beginning to end, she was simply afraid that she wouldn't be able to take care of them, so she tried everything she could to ensure the little bears could survive.
But she had never had her own child, and this was the first time she had acted as a guide for Little Bear, so she had to explore on her own, trying to find the right path.
On this shared path of exploration, they all need to work hard to truly see the direction they want to move in.
However, the cost of trial and error varies, and wrong choices will come at a price.
Even though Xiaoxiong never harbored any resentment towards Guomi, she couldn't hide her guilt.
Guo Mi lowered her head and rubbed the teddy bear again and again, carefully avoiding the wounds on their bodies, her heart filled with a mixture of fear and relief.
"Go away——"
The sudden, sharp shout was like a razor-sharp knife, shattering the three bears' cozy time together.
It was Xia Tian's voice. Guo Mi was stunned for two seconds before she remembered that a male bear that shouldn't have been there had just appeared. She cursed herself for being so focused on the little bear that she had forgotten about this and hurriedly turned her head to look.
She was completely baffled after seeing it!
Because summer didn't drive away Caesar, but rather...
Slok?!
The three bears standing not far away have a very strange posture.
Summer held Big White firmly behind her, while Slok stood opposite Summer, raising one front paw as if he wanted to walk over, but Summer stopped him, leaving him in a dilemma.
The male bear's eyes were filled with grievance, yet lingering joy still shone through.
"Summer, we haven't seen each other in so long, why are you being so mean to me..."
However, Xia Tian didn't buy it at all, baring her teeth and threatening:
"Step back, don't come any closer."
Slok could only lower its forward-moving paws, silently taking two steps back. It looked longingly at Xia Tian, its gaze finally landing on the big white dog behind Xia Tian. Its eyes lit up, and it couldn't help but move forward again.
This really enraged Xia Tian. The mother bear charged at him furiously and slapped him several times with her paws!
Slok didn't dodge; he just crouched down, tucked his head in, and took the beating!
Summer didn't hold back either, slapping Slok on the head five or six times in one go!
Guo Mi watched in stunned silence, and quietly asked the two little bears:
"what happened?"
Summer showed no mercy with those claws, the force of which was no less than what Caesar usually used on Sloch. How could Sloch, who is so afraid of pain, have endured it?!
The two little bears also looked puzzled:
"I don't know, we were surrounded by a pack of wolves, and then Slock rushed over to help us drive them away, and then Summer rushed over too..."
what? !
Guo Mi couldn't help but ask:
"Didn't they fight?"
The little bears' expressions immediately became even stranger, and they both denied it:
"No, they drove the wolves away together."
Guo Mi felt speechless for a moment.
Something's not right. Last summer, he only caught a glimpse of Caesar from afar and then disappeared for months. How come Slok is now fighting alongside him?
Even though Slok is notorious for his cowardice, he is still an adult male bear. Putting aside everything else, his physique is much stronger than that of an average male bear. Given Xia Tian's personality, how could he possibly let him get that close?
Is it...
Guo Mi glanced at Slok, then at the big white dog behind Xia Tian, and suddenly remembered some of the things Slok had said to her. A terrible guess almost jumped out of her mind!
